SBO seeks a grant manager to provide post-award (grant) management to their associated departments within UAF.
Duties:
As our Grant Manager, you will join a caring and fun team at the Signers' Business Office (SBO) in providing fiscal and grant award management for the units that SBO serves.
Every day we'll rely on you to manage a grant portfolio by determining projections for expenditures and resolve issues by researching what spending is allowed and not allowed for each grant.
You will use existing reports (Excel & TOAD) to keep track of these grants and when they will expire and provide this information to our Principal Investigators, the Office of Grant and Contract Administration, necessary university financial systems, and various funding agencies.
Primary funding agencies include USDA (capacity awards), State of Alaska, Dept.
of Education, Native Corporations, and the National Science Foundation.
The ideal candidate will be friendly, professional and possess a basic knowledge of general accounting principles.
Additionally, you will be a liaison for funding agencies, departmental researchers, and other campus departments on budget, grant management, fiscal, financial, and accounting matters on assigned restricted grants.
To thrive in this role, you must be able to respond in a timely manner to a diverse group of people, who often have quite interesting research they are conducting that not only affects UAF, but can ultimately help the people of Alaska.
A strong attention to detail as well as analytical skills is a must as this position prepares and submits budget revisions, journal vouchers, and labor redistributions.
Proficiency in pulling data from existing reports, and having the ability to read and decipher award documents are necessary skills the successful applicant must be capable of completing.
While grant experience is helpful to already have, we will train the right candidate.

Don't Be Fooled

The fraudster will send a check to the victim who has accepted a job. The check can be for multiple reasons such as signing bonus, supplies, etc. The victim will be instructed to deposit the check and use the money for any of these reasons and then instructed to send the remaining funds to the fraudster. The check will bounce and the victim is left responsible.
